Clues in the cucumber’s climb

Harvard researchers, captivated by a strange coiling behavior in the grasping tendrils of the cucumber plant, have characterized a new type of spring that is soft when pulled gently and stiff when pulled strongly.   Original post on harvard.edu    Comments on reddit.com
